mirror of
https://github.com/kataras/iris.git
synced 2025-12-20 03:17:04 +00:00
reorganization of _examples and add some new examples such as iris+groupcache+mysql+docker
Former-commit-id: ed635ee95de7160cde11eaabc0c1dcb0e460a620
This commit is contained in:
33
_examples/kafka-api/README.md
Normal file
33
_examples/kafka-api/README.md
Normal file
@@ -0,0 +1,33 @@
|
||||
# Writing an API for Apache Kafka with Iris
|
||||
|
||||
Read the [code](main.go).
|
||||
|
||||
## Docker
|
||||
|
||||
1. Open [docker-compose.yml](docker-compose.yml) and replace `KAFKA_ADVERTISED_HOST_NAME` with your own local address
|
||||
2. Install [Docker](https://www.docker.com/)
|
||||
3. Execute the command below to start kafka stack and the go application:
|
||||
|
||||
```sh
|
||||
$ docker-compose up
|
||||
```
|
||||
|
||||
## Manually
|
||||
|
||||
Install & run Kafka and Zookeper locally and then:
|
||||
|
||||
```sh
|
||||
go run main.go
|
||||
```
|
||||
|
||||
## Screens
|
||||
|
||||

|
||||
|
||||

|
||||
|
||||

|
||||
|
||||

|
||||
|
||||

|
||||
Reference in New Issue
Block a user